China's first domestically made large cruise ship Adora Magic City marks a major milestone for the country's shipbuilding industry. The ship will have its inaugural commercial voyage on January 1, 2024.
The Adora Magic City's statistics are mind-boggling. The 135,500-gross-tonnage jumbo ship can accommodate a maximum of 5,246 passengers in its 2,125 guest rooms who will be served by 1,292 crew members from around the world.
It is also equipped with a 16-story, 40,000-square-meter living and entertainment public area, which is known as a "modern city on the sea".
To make the vessel function, there are 107 different systems, 25 million parts and components, 4,750 kilometers of cables and 365 km of pipes. The ship was built by China State Shipbuilding Corporation's Shanghai Waigaoqiao Shipbuilding Co.
